A heterogenous Cournot duopoly model with discrete delay and externalities
In this article, we consider a nonlinear continuous-time model with discrete delays and externalities. | Sumario: | In this article, we consider a nonlinear continuous-time model with discrete delays and externalities. We study the dynamic competitors’s behavior, when they are heterogeneous in determining the output decisions.
We have determined a unique positive equilibrium solution and we have applied mathematical techniques (Nyquist criterion) to estimate the range of the delays for which the equilibrium state remains asyntotically stable. |
